vue中的生命周期函數(shù)是什么
Vue 中的生命周期函數(shù)
在 Vue.js 中,生命周期函數(shù)是一系列預(yù)定義的回調(diào)函數(shù),可以在組件創(chuàng)建、更新和銷(xiāo)毀的不同階段調(diào)用。這些函數(shù)允許我們自定義組件的行為并響應(yīng)各種事件。
Vue 中的生命周期函數(shù)列表:
創(chuàng)建階段:
:在實(shí)例初始化之前調(diào)用。
:在實(shí)例初始化之后調(diào)用。
:在掛載到 DOM 之前調(diào)用。
:在掛載到 DOM 之后調(diào)用。
更新階段:
:在虛擬 DOM 更新之前調(diào)用。
:在虛擬 DOM 更新之后調(diào)用。
銷(xiāo)毀階段:
:在實(shí)例銷(xiāo)毀之前調(diào)用。
:在實(shí)例銷(xiāo)毀之后調(diào)用。
用法:
生命周期函數(shù)可在組件中通過(guò)以下方式使用:
<code class="js">export default {
data() {
return {
// ...
};
},
methods: {
// ...
},
created() {
// ...
},
mounted() {
// ...
},
beforeDestroy() {
// ...
},
};</code>
重要性:
生命周期函數(shù)對(duì)于管理組件狀態(tài)、處理異步操作和向組件添加自定義行為至關(guān)重要。通過(guò)利用生命周期函數(shù),我們可以創(chuàng)建更具響應(yīng)性和可控性的 Vue 組件。
上一篇:vue中slot的作用
相關(guān)推薦
-
vue中實(shí)例對(duì)象是什么
Vue 中的實(shí)例對(duì)象簡(jiǎn)要回答:Vue 中的實(shí)例對(duì)象是一個(gè)管理 Vue 應(yīng)用程序狀態(tài)和行為的核心對(duì)象。它包含了所有響應(yīng)式數(shù)據(jù)、方法、計(jì)算屬性、生命周期鉤子等。詳細(xì)回答:實(shí)例對(duì)象的創(chuàng)建當(dāng)使用 Vue 創(chuàng)建
-
vue中的組件是什么意思
Vue 中的組件組件是 Vue.js 中代碼復(fù)用的一種方式。它們是獨(dú)立、可重用的代碼塊,可以用于創(chuàng)建更復(fù)雜的應(yīng)用程序。組件的好處代碼重用:組件允許您將代碼塊重復(fù)使用于應(yīng)用程序的不同部分,避免重復(fù)代碼。
-
vue中的組件有幾類(lèi)
Vue 中組件的類(lèi)型Vue 組件可分為三類(lèi):1. 基礎(chǔ)組件這些是 Vue 核心庫(kù)中內(nèi)置的組件,例如 、 和 。它們提供基本功能,如數(shù)據(jù)綁定、條件渲染和事件處理。2. 自定義組件這些是開(kāi)發(fā)人員創(chuàng)建的組件
-
vue中每個(gè)單文件組件由什么構(gòu)成
Vue 單文件組件的構(gòu)成Vue 單文件組件由三個(gè)部分構(gòu)成:1. 模板(template)模板部分定義了組件的視覺(jué)表現(xiàn)。它使用 HTML 語(yǔ)法編寫(xiě),并可以使用 Vue 指令和插值來(lái)動(dòng)態(tài)渲染數(shù)據(jù)。2. 腳
-
vue中的組件實(shí)質(zhì)是什么
Vue 中組件的實(shí)質(zhì)在 Vue.js 中,組件是可重用的、獨(dú)立且封裝的代碼塊,可以創(chuàng)建出更復(fù)雜和可維護(hù)的應(yīng)用程序。組件的實(shí)質(zhì)是:一個(gè)封裝了數(shù)據(jù)、模板和方法的 JavaScript 對(duì)象數(shù)據(jù):組件定義了















